Tonight, I’ll be specifically talking about word-of-mouth advertising. As we all know, billions of dollars are spent on advertising every year.
Well, do you prefer to buy products recommended by an advertiser or your friends? Personally, I prefer the latter, because I trust my friends. So, word-of-mouth advertising happens when a person tells another person about the good experience with a product or service. That second person then tells another friend, family member, or colleague. By contrast, traditional advertisers talk about how good their products are. Usually, they say things like "Studies show that our products are the best. “, or "Everyone loves our products. " , but it can sound insincere or unconvincing. And some statistics also prove that word-of-mouth advertising is more reliable and effective.
According to a new study from NOP World, 93% of people believe word-of-mouth is the most reliable way to find out information about products and services, 70% of people are affected by it, 37% will buy it or try it, 24% will consider it and merely 9% will avoid it.
So, it’s obvious that word-of-mouth advertising has many advantages like high credibility, low costs, great reach and high efficiency. Do you agree with me? And the main reasons for the wide popularity of word-of-mouth advertising are also apparent. Socializing and networking have now made people closer and closer. So relatives and friends are simply accessible over the net.
